The celebration begins on the night of Holy Saturday, when the young men of the town go out to the nearby orchards to collect a variety of vegetables, bunches of oranges and lemons, all while carrying the throne of San Juan on their shoulders. With what they collect, they decorate the Plaza de la Vera Cruz, forming the traditional and colorful Huerto del Niño.
On Easter Sunday, at 10:00 in the morning, Holy Mass is celebrated and then a very special procession takes place: San Juan, loaded with oranges and lemons, meets the Virgin Mary, who asks him about the whereabouts of her Son. The scene recreates the exciting moment when San Juan tells her that he has seen the Child in the Orchard, and together they go to meet him in the square.
This event takes place in an atmosphere of solemnity and emotion, and after the performance, the neighbours come to the Huerto del Niño to take part in a peculiar auction. During the morning, the inhabitants of the town donate animals, plants, vegetables and other products, which are then auctioned off, and the proceeds go to charity.
The setting for this celebration is the charming Plaza de la Vera Cruz, with the hermitage of the same name as a backdrop, which adds a magical and traditional touch to this festivity. In addition, Holy Week in Benarrabá also includes other highlights, such as the Via Crucis on Good Friday morning, where the image of the Christ of the Vera Cruz walks through the streets of the town and visits the sick, and the moving procession of the Virgen de la Soledad, which leaves from the church of the Encarnación at 11 pm.
